For all of those who are not familiar with Baltimore it is quite the interesting place. You have your Big 3 neighborhoods (Federal Hill, Fell's Point and Canton) and then you have other smaller neighborhoods with character! We decided to visit Mt. Vernon home to America's first monument to George Washington! Mt. Vernon is known for its cultural district, filled with stretches of restaurants from all different backgrounds.
